Seagate Ships World’s First 4TB HD With Four 1TB Platters

Seagate will be shipping a 4TB hard drive that has the distinction of being the world’s first to include a 1TB per platter design. This basically means that each spinning disk in the hard drive has a capacity of 1TB, and that there are four of them. It’s not everyday that you can claim to that have something that’s the “world’s first”, so don’t be too hard on Seagate. This certainly isn’t the first hard drive to have a 4TB capacity, but apparently the new 1TB per platter design significantly increases the hard drive’s performance over the competition. It consumes 35 percent less power than comparable drives on the market with 4TB capacities, and at 145MB/s, it has the highest average data rate as well. But most importantly, the new design will also bring down costs. A hard drive in an external casing can be had for $212, while just the bare drive will cost around $190. Disney Closes LucasArts

An anonymous reader sends news that Disney is closing LucasArts. The game studio has been around since 1982, and brought us classics such as Labyrinth, The Secret of Monkey Island, X-Wing, TIE Fighter, and Star Wars: Battlefront. They also published Star Wars: Galaxies, Knights of the Old Republic, and Star Wars: The Old Republic. The company held a meeting today informing employees of the layoffs. “In some ways, the news is not a surprise. LucasArts had seemed directionless in recent years. The company’s core business of games based on the Star Wars license have been largely disappointing in both quality and sales. While the company had some success with games like Star Wars: The Force Unleashed and the Battlefront series, both of those franchises seemed to have died on the vine. The cancellation of Star Wars Battlefront III was particularly ugly, which led to nasty public fingerpointing between LucasArts and developer Free Radical. … LucasArt’s other big franchise, Indiana Jones, has failed to make much of a dent in games in recent years, with the exception of Traveller’s Tales LEGO Indiana Jones series that, once again, was not developed by LucasArts. Meanwhile, series like Uncharted and Tomb Raider, which are both heavily influenced by the Indiana Jones films, have thrived.” If only they hadn’t abandoned the X-Wing series of games. Report: Troubled Doom 4 being retargeted for next-generation systems

Nearly five years after it was officially announced and nine years after the release of Doom 3 , we’ve heard precious little about the development of Id Software’s Doom 4 . It seems that silence has masked a troubled development cycle that has been restarted at least once and is currently not all that close to being finished. Kotaku talked to a number of unnamed sources “with connections to the Id Software-developed game” and lays out a tale of mismanaged resources and distractions. Chief among these distractions was Rage , the 2011 release that developer Id thought would put it back on top of the first-person shooter heap. When that game was  savaged by harsh reviews and low sales, Id reportedly halted plans for DLC and a sequel and refocused the entire company on Doom 4 , which had largely languished during the work on Rage . “I kinda think maybe the studio heads were so distracted on shipping Rage that they were blind to the happenings of Doom , and the black hole of mediocrity [the team] was swirling around,” one source told Kotaku. FTC reveals $50,000 Robocall Challenge winners, alarms Rachel from card services (video)

The FTC has managed to find two non-violent solutions to its Robocall Challenge , aimed at blocking auto-dialing telemarketers, thanks to winners Serdar Danis and Aaron Foss. The pair, who will receive $25,000 each, came up with variations on a system that would pre-screen calls before ringing your phone while allowing the FTC to blacklist known scammers at the same time. Google took a non-cash prize in a separate category with a scheme that would foil caller-ID spoofing often used by boiler rooms like the notorious “Rachel from card services” outfit, which has over a hundred numeric aliases. The FTC receives a whopping 200,000 complaints per month about the nuisance and screened nearly 800 submissions (see the More Coverage link), many of which show a certain, shall we say, passion for the topic. AMD Releases UVD Engine Source Code

An anonymous reader writes “Years of desire by AMD Linux users to have open source video playback support by their graphics driver is now over. AMD has released open-source UVD support for their Linux driver so users can have hardware-accelerated video playback of H.264, VC-1, and MPEG video formats. UVD support on years old graphics cards was delayed because AMD feared open-source support could kill their Digital Rights Management abilities for other platforms.” Read more of this story at Slashdot.

Nebula One turns servers into simple, private clouds with OpenStack (video)

Trying to create a large-scale, private cloud array can be a headache, since it often involves bringing disparate networking, server and storage systems together in one not-so-happy union. Wouldn’t it be nice to have a box that could do most of the hard work? Nebula thinks its newly launched Nebula One controller will do the trick. The rackmount device’s Cosmos OS quickly turns ordinary servers from the likes of Dell or HP into a unified cloud computer that centers on the more universal OpenStack platform, and which can also talk to Amazon Web Services . IT admins have a single interface to oversee the whole lot while skipping any outside help, and can scale up to a hefty 1,600 processor cores, 9.4TB of memory and 2.3PB of storage. You’ll have to ask Nebula directly about pricing, although we suspect it’s counting on the classic battle between time and money to clinch a deal — the weeks saved in setup and maintenance could represent the real discount. Solid electrolyte may end the catastrophic failures of lithium batteries

Batteries like this one with liquid electrolytes may eventually get a run for their money. pinkyracer Lithium batteries have become a very popular technology, powering everything from cell phones to cars. But that doesn’t mean the technology is without its problems; lithium batteries have been implicated in some critical technological snafus, from exploding laptops to grounded airplanes . Most of these problems can be traced back to the electrolyte, a liquid that helps ions carry charges within the battery. Liquid electrolytes can leak, burn, and distort the internal structure of the battery, swelling it in ways that can lead to a catastrophic failure. The solution, of course, would be to get rid of the liquids. But ions don’t tend to move as easily through solids, which creates another set of problems. Now, researchers have formulated a solid in which lithium ions can move about five times faster than any previously described substance. Better yet, the solid—a close chemical relative of styrofoam—helps provide structural stability to the battery. Don’t expect to see a styrofoam battery in your next cellphone though, as the material needs to be heated to 60°C in order to work. The problem with liquid electrolytes has to do with the fact that, during recharging, lithium ions end up forming deposits of metal inside the battery. These create risks of short circuits (the problem that grounded Boeing’s Dreamliner 787) and can damage the battery’s structure, causing leaks and a fire risk. Solid electrodes get around this because the lithium ions will only come out of the electrolyte at specific locations within the solid, and can’t form the large metal deposits that cause all of the problems.
